Programming: q parameters – HEIDENHAIN TNC 620 (340 56x-03) User Manual

Page 23

Advertising
background image

HEIDENHAIN TNC 620

23

8.1 Principle and Overview ..... 230

Programming notes ..... 231

Calling Q-parameter functions ..... 232

8.2 Part Families—Q Parameters in Place of Numerical Values ..... 233

Function ..... 233

8.3 Describing Contours through Mathematical Operations ..... 234

Application ..... 234

Overview ..... 234

Programming fundamental operations ..... 235

8.4 Trigonometric Functions ..... 236

Definitions ..... 236

Programming trigonometric functions ..... 237

8.5 Circle Calculations ..... 238

Application ..... 238

8.6 If-Then Decisions with Q Parameters ..... 239

Application ..... 239

Unconditional jumps ..... 239

Programming If-Then decisions ..... 239

Abbreviations used: ..... 240

8.7 Checking and Changing Q Parameters ..... 241

Procedure ..... 241

8.8 Additional Functions ..... 242

Overview ..... 242

FN 14: ERROR: Displaying error messages ..... 243

FN 16: F-PRINT: Formatted output of text and Q-parameter values ..... 248

FN 18: SYS-DATUM READ ..... 252

FN 19: PLC: Transfer values to the PLC ..... 261

FN 20: WAIT FOR: NC and PLC synchronization ..... 261

FN 29: PLC: Transfer values to the PLC ..... 262

FN37: EXPORT ..... 263

8.9 Accessing Tables with SQL Commands ..... 264

Introduction ..... 264

A Transaction ..... 265

Programming SQL commands ..... 267

Overview of the soft keys ..... 267

SQL BIND ..... 268

SQL SELECT ..... 269

SQL FETCH ..... 272

SQL UPDATE ..... 273

SQL INSERT ..... 273

SQL COMMIT ..... 274

SQL ROLLBACK ..... 274

8 Programming: Q Parameters ..... 229

Advertising